Elastic Overkill: Is Cloud Really The Be-All End-All for Everyone?

Slides:



Advertisements
Similar presentations
System Center 2012 R2 Overview
Advertisements

What’s New: Windows Server 2012 R2 Tim Vander Kooi Systems Architect
Agile Infrastructure built on OpenStack Building The Next Generation Data Center with OpenStack John Griffith, Senior Software Engineer,
Profit from the cloud TM Parallels Dynamic Infrastructure AndOpenStack.
Orchestration of Fibre Channel Technologies for Private Cloud Deployments OpenStack Summit; Ecosystem Track April 15 th, 2013 Oregon Convention Center.
1 Security on OpenStack 11/7/2013 Brian Chong – Global Technology Strategist.
Virtualization for Cloud Computing
Cloud computing Tahani aljehani.
Cisco and OpenStack Lew Tucker VP/CTO Cloud Computing Cisco Systems,
Cloud Computing Why is it called the cloud?.
Opensource for Cloud Deployments – Risk – Reward – Reality
INTRODUCTION TO CLOUD COMPUTING CS 595 LECTURE 7 2/23/2015.
Introduction to VMware Virtualization
What is Driving the Virtual Desktop? VMware View 4: Built for Desktops VMware View 4: Deployment References…Q&A Agenda.
608D CloudStack 3.0 Omer Palo Readiness Specialist, WW Tech Support Readiness May 8, 2012.
Eucalyptus 3 (&3.1). Eucalyptus 3 Product Overview – Govind Rangasamy.
Windows Azure Virtual Machines Anton Boyko. A Continuous Offering From Private to Public Cloud.
CoprHD and OpenStack Ideas for future.
20409A 7: Installing and Configuring System Center 2012 R2 Virtual Machine Manager Module 7 Installing and Configuring System Center 2012 R2 Virtual.
© 2015 VMware Inc. All rights reserved. Software-Defined Data Center Module 2.
Unit 2 VIRTUALISATION. Unit 2 - Syllabus Basics of Virtualization Types of Virtualization Implementation Levels of Virtualization Virtualization Structures.
OVirt Overview Copyright 2012 under Apache License 2.0 | Presentation 1 oVirt Overview Karsten Sr. Community Architect,
Open Source Virtualization Andrey Meganov RHCA, RHCX Consultant / VDEL
OPENSTACK Presented by Jordan Howell and Katie Woods.
Integrating oVirt and Foreman to Empower your Data-Center
oVirt: How to Connect with a Mature Open Source Project
Prof. Jong-Moon Chung’s Lecture Notes at Yonsei University
OpenStack.
Network customization
Course: Cluster, grid and cloud computing systems Course author: Prof
Virtualization for Cloud Computing
Guide to Operating Systems, 5th Edition
Security on OpenStack 11/7/2013
Chapter 6: Securing the Cloud
Interoperability Between Modern Clouds using DevOps
Organizations Are Embracing New Opportunities
Introduction to VMware Virtualization
OVirt Architecture Itamar Heim
Open Source Virtualization with oVirt
Project Overview Amador Pahim (apahim) oVirt Contributor
SUSE® Cloud The Open Source Private Cloud Solution for the Enterprise
Don’t Miss These Sessions!
Prepared by: Assistant prof. Aslamzai
oVirt Node Project Douglas Schilling Landgraf
Welcome! Thank you for joining us. We’ll get started in a few minutes.
A walkthrought by the cloud computing
Integrando o Docker em seu ambiente de Virtualização
MOM + oVirt: Nurturing our Virtual Machines
Interoperability in Modern Clouds using DevOps
Red Hat User Group June 2014 Marco Berube, Cloud Solutions Architect
OpenStack Ani Bicaku 18/04/ © (SG)² Konsortium.
OPNFV Arno Installation & Validation Walk-Through
Managing Clouds with VMM
Yellowfin: An Azure-Compatible Business Intelligence Platform That Connects People with Their Data for Better Decision Making MICROSOFT AZURE APP BUILDER.
Be Better: Achieve Customer Service Excellence and Create a Lean RMA and Returns Process with Renewity RMA and the Power of Microsoft Azure MICROSOFT AZURE.
Scalable SoftNAS Cloud Protects Customers’ Mission-Critical Data in the Cloud with a Highly Available, Flexible Solution for Microsoft Azure MICROSOFT.
20409A 7: Installing and Configuring System Center 2012 R2 Virtual Machine Manager Module 7 Installing and Configuring System Center 2012 R2 Virtual.
Data Security for Microsoft Azure
HC Hyper-V Module GUI Portal VPS Templates Web Console
Guide to Operating Systems, 5th Edition
OpenStack-alapú privát felhő üzemeltetés
* Introduction to Cloud computing * Introduction to OpenStack * OpenStack Design & Architecture * Demonstration of OpenStack Cloud.
Different types of Linux installation
Future Internet: Infrastructures and Services
Last.Backend is a Continuous Delivery Platform for Developers and Dev Teams, Allowing Them to Manage and Deploy Applications Easier and Faster MICROSOFT.
Future Internet: Infrastructures and Services
Network customization
OpenStack Summit Berlin – November 14, 2018
OpenStack for the Enterprise
Presentation transcript:

Elastic Overkill: Is Cloud Really The Be-All End-All for Everyone? FISL 15 Brian Proffitt oVirt Community Manager bkp@redhat.com @TheTechScribe

Cloud, cloud, cloud.

I Blame Amazon.com.

I Blame Amazon.com. Really.

Founded in 1995, Amazon soon became one of the flagship user of cloud technologies, thanks to Christmas and holiday buying patterns that placed massive seasonal loads on their servers. Which they then decided to rent out.

Elasticity Is The Secret Sauce. Elasticity and automation of resources is the key to cloud computing.

But What About Everyone Else?

Size Doesn't Matter.

Enterprise, Start-up, Consumer... In The Cloud, No One Cares If You're A Suit

...It's All The Same. From an IT perspective, work is about delivering services to the end user. At a fundamental level, it does not matter if you are providing services to 10 users or 1000.

You = Provider It's all about one provider...

Them = Customer ...and one user.

One Of You. Many Of Them. But the world is not virtual. It's still a one-to-many relationship.

How Do You Scale?

Welcome to Virtualization Land

What Virtualization Delivers

Coding for cloud (automation, scalability) is not necessary. After Coding for cloud (automation, scalability) is not necessary. Easier migration Faster return on investment Before

Hardware Consolidation Fewer, bigger servers

Workload Management Oversubscribed services get more hardware

Application Protection Fault tolerance High availability Live migration Quality of Service Network Disk Compute Memory

Resource Scalability Add more hardware and modify resources allocated to VM on the fly

Legacy Applications Coding for cloud (automation, scalability) is not necessary.

Ganeti KVM management application Open Source alternative to vSphere Widely deployed hypervisor Hosted by Linux Foundation since April 2013 Ganeti Developed by Google to manage clusters Manages KVM and Xen nodes

oVirt

oVirt: Large-Scale, Centralized Large-scale centralized management for server and desktop virtualization.

oVirt: Scalable Based on leading performance, scalability and security infrastructures.

oVirt: vSphere Alternative Open source vCenter/vSphere alternative

oVirt: Community Merit-based open governance model Built using the best concepts from the Apache and Eclipse foundations. Governance split between board and projects oVirt Projects Multiple Projects under the oVirt brand

Header: This bar contains the name of the logged in user, the sign out button, the option to configure user roles. Navigation Pane: This pane allows you to navigate between the Tree, Bookmarks and Tags tabs. In the Tree tab, tree mode allows you to see the entire system tree and provides a visual representation your virtualization environment's architecture. Resources Tabs: These tabs allow you to access the resources of oVirt. You should already have a Default Data Center, a Default Cluster, a Host waiting to be approved, and available Storage waiting to be attached to the data center. Results List: When you select a tab, this list displays the available resources. You can perform a task on an individual item or multiple items by selecting the item(s) and then clicking the relevant action button. If an action is not possible, the button is disabled. Details Pane: When you select a resource, this pane displays its details in several subtabs. These subtabs also contain action buttons which you can use to make changes to the selected resource.

Merit-based open governance model Built using the best concepts from the Apache and Eclipse foundations. Governance split between board and projects oVirt Projects Multiple Projects under the oVirt brand

JBoss-based Java application Communicates with hypervisor nodes Engine JBoss-based Java application Communicates with hypervisor nodes Manages VM lifecycle Controlled with Admin Portal User Portal REST API Python SDK CLI

Stand-alone hypervisor Small footprint ~170 MB Engine Stand-alone hypervisor Small footprint ~170 MB Customized “spin” of Fedora and CentOS with KVM “Just enough” Fedora to run virtual machines Runs on all RHEL/CentOS hardware with Intel VT/AMD-V CPUs Easy to install, configure, and upgrade PXE boot, USB boot, CD, or hard drive Full Host Fedora, RHEL or CentOS host, with an installed VDSM and libvirt to act as a hypervisor Flexible Add monitoring agents, scripts, etc. Leverage existing OS infrastructure Hybrid mode capable Node

Local storage on the VMs Storage domains such as NFS iSCSI Engine Local storage on the VMs Storage domains such as NFS iSCSI Fibre Channel POSIX storage (Gluster) Storage domains Disk images for Vms Exported Vms .ISO images for installation media Node Storage

Have We Met?

A subset of the OpenStack Basic Tenants DASHBOARD (Horizon) IDENTITY SERVICE (Keystone) COMPUTE (Nova) BLOCK STORAGE (Cinder) NETWORKING (Quantum) IMAGE SERVICE (Glance) OBJECT STORE (Swift) A subset of the OpenStack Basic Tenants Scalability and elasticity are the main goals Any feature that limits our main goals must be optional All required components must be horizontally scalable Always use shared-nothing architecture

Engine/Dashboard Identity Reporting Node/Compute Storage

Servers are like cattle. oVirt OpenStack Scale up Scale out HA VMs – expect to stay up Stateless VMs – expect to be redundant Resiliency in platform Resiliency in application VMs need shared storage Need to define VLANs Needs dashboard Scale Up Servers are like pets. Pets are given names, are unique, lovingly hand raised and cared for. When they get ill, you nurse them back to health Scale Out Servers are like cattle. Cattle are given numbers and are almost identical to each other. When they get ill, you get another one.

oVirt: Virtualization Now...

... With Cloud Later

Shared image storage with Glance Horizon FreeIPA for Identity, shared with Keystone Neutron for SDN Nova Driver for oVirt Shared image storage with Glance Shared block storage (Gluster, NFS, iSCSI, FCoE for oVirt, Cinder for OpenStack, consuming same storage) Shared SDN framework (define oVirt VLANS with Neutron) Ability to monitor and control oVirt VMs in Horizon Freedom to gradually migrate “old” to “new” Glance, Cinder

One Path To Performance Get virtualization savings now, with cloud complexity “Single pane of glass” to allow management of traditional virtualization and private and public IaaS Enables policy enforcement Facilitates service migration Frees you from vendor lock-in CloudForms Management Engine – Open Sourcing soon.

THANK YOU ! http://ovirt.org/ #ovirt irc.oftc.net users@ovirt.org